Tactical Analysis: How the Teams Might Line Up

Predicting the tactical setups of both teams adds another layer of intrigue to the match preview. Understanding how each team is likely to approach the game can give us insights into their strategies and potential strengths and weaknesses. Let's delve into a tactical analysis of Nigeria and Benin, examining their possible formations and how they might look to exploit each other.

Nigeria is likely to stick with their preferred 4-3-3 formation, which allows them to maximize their attacking talent. This formation provides a solid balance between defense and attack, allowing the Super Eagles to control possession and create scoring opportunities. The 4-3-3 setup utilizes three forwards, providing width and attacking threat in the final third. The midfield three must work cohesively to support both the defense and the attack, controlling the tempo of the game and providing creative input. The full-backs also play a crucial role, offering width in attack and providing defensive cover. This formation relies on a strong central spine and coordinated movement throughout the team. Nigeria's players are well-suited to this system, and it allows them to showcase their individual skills within a structured framework.

Benin, on the other hand, might opt for a more cautious 4-5-1 formation, focusing on defensive solidity and hitting Nigeria on the counter-attack. This formation prioritizes defensive stability, aiming to frustrate the opposition and limit their scoring opportunities. The five midfielders provide a compact shield in front of the defense, making it difficult for the opposition to break through. The lone striker will need to be clinical and efficient, capitalizing on any chances that come their way. The full-backs will also play a crucial role in both defense and attack, providing width and supporting the counter-attacks. This tactical approach is designed to make Benin difficult to beat and to exploit any defensive weaknesses in the Nigerian team. Benin's focus will be on disciplined defending and quick transitions, aiming to make the most of their limited possession.
